Soshanguve Ww is a residential section of the broader Soshanguve township north of Pretoria in Gauteng, offering a mix of established houses and open plots that appeal to a wide range of buyers and investors.
About Soshanguve Ww
Soshanguve Ww forms part of the well-known Soshanguve township, one of Gauteng's larger residential communities situated north of Pretoria's city centre. Like other sections within Soshanguve, the WW area is characterised by a strong sense of community and a predominantly residential character. It is home to a diverse population and continues to attract buyers looking for accessible entry points into the Gauteng property market.
Property Types and Prices
The property landscape in Soshanguve Ww is led by houses, which make up the bulk of available stock, alongside plots for those looking to build from scratch or invest in land. With 329 active listings on Liivra, there is a reasonable variety of options to explore. Houses here tend to be freestanding and range from modest starter homes to more established family residences. Plots offer an opportunity for buyers who want to design and build their own home, which can be an appealing and cost-effective route for first-time buyers or developers.
Who Is Soshanguve Ww Suited To?
This area tends to attract first-time homebuyers looking for affordable entry into homeownership, as well as buy-to-let investors who see value in the rental demand that comes with a large, active community. Families already rooted in the broader Soshanguve area often look within WW when upgrading or seeking more space. The availability of plots also makes it relevant for those with a longer-term building plan in mind. It is generally a practical, community-focused choice rather than a lifestyle-driven one, which suits buyers who prioritise value and accessibility over premium amenities.
Getting Around and Day-to-Day Living
Soshanguve is well connected to Pretoria and surrounding areas via road networks and public transport routes, making commuting a manageable part of daily life for many residents. The broader Soshanguve area has established retail, healthcare, and community facilities that serve the day-to-day needs of residents. As with many township areas in Gauteng, the community infrastructure continues to develop, and buyers should visit the area in person to get a feel for the specific streets and surroundings within WW before committing.
